What is Term Life Insurance?

Term Life Insurance provides coverage for a specific period, making it an
affordable option for those looking to protect their family during critical
financial years. Whether it’s covering a mortgage, replacing lost income, or
securing your children’s education, Term Life Insurance offers peace of mind
at a price that fits your budget. Our agency works with top carriers to help
you find the term length and coverage amount that suits your needs.

Comparison Table for Term Life Insurance Page

Term Life Insurance vs. Whole Life Insurance vs. Final Expense Insurance

FeatureFinal Expense InsuranceTerm Life InsuranceWhole Life Insurance
Coverage DurationLifetime coverage focused on end-of-life expenses.Fixed term coverage (e.g., 10, 20, 30 years).Lifetime coverage as long as premiums are paid.
PremiumsAffordable, fixed premiums designed to fit tight budgets.Lower premiums during the term; may increase upon renewal.Higher premiums that remain level throughout the policy.
Cash Value ComponentBuilds modest cash value that can be accessed if needed.No cash value accumulation; pure death benefit.Builds cash value over time that can be borrowed against or withdrawn.
Death BenefitSmaller, fixed death benefit intended to cover funeral and related expenses.Death benefit paid only if death occurs during the term; fixed amount.Guaranteed death benefit paid to beneficiaries; amount can be flexible.
PurposeCovering funeral costs, medical bills, and other end-of-life expenses to ease the burden on family.Temporary financial protection for specific periods (e.g., mortgage repayment, raising children).Long-term financial planning, wealth accumulation, estate planning.
Medical Exam RequirementOften no medical exam required; acceptance based on answers to health questions.Typically requires a medical exam; premiums based on health, age, and term length.Varies based on death benefit amount
Ideal ForSeniors and individuals wanting to ensure final expenses are covered without burdening loved ones.Individuals needing affordable, temporary coverage for specific financial obligations.Individuals seeking lifelong coverage and a savings/ investment component.
Pros- Easy qualification - Affordable premiums- Lifetime coverage - Cash value growth- Lifetime coverage - Cash value growth
Feature- Peace of mind for end- of-life expenses.- Affordable premiums - Simple to understand - Flexible term lengths.- Potential dividends - Can borrow against policy.
Cons- Lower death benefit - Limited cash value growth - Not suitable for large financial needs.- Coverage expires at end of term - No cash value - Premiums can increase upon renewal.- Higher premiums - Complex policies - Potential surrender charges if canceled early.

Term Life Insurance provides coverage for a specified period,
while Whole Life Insurance offers lifelong coverage with a cash value
component. Term Life is generally more affordable, making it a good
option for temporary needs.

The length of your term should match your financial obligations,
such as the length of your mortgage, the time until your children are
financially independent, or the duration of your income replacement
needs.

Many Term Life policies offer a conversion option, allowing you to
switch to a Whole Life policy without a medical exam, typically before
the term ends.

If you outlive your term, the coverage ends, and no death benefit
is paid out. Some policies offer renewal options, but the premium may
increase.

Premiums are based on factors such as your age, health, lifestyle,
and the term length and coverage amount you choose.

Term Life Insurance is ideal if you need affordable coverage for a
specific period, such as until your mortgage is paid off or your children
are grown.

A level premium means that your payments remain the same
throughout the term, making it easier to budget.

Yes, you can cancel your policy at any time. However, you won’t
receive a refund of premiums paid if you cancel before the term ends.

A renewable policy allows you to renew your Term Life Insurance
at the end of the term without undergoing a medical exam, although
premiums may increase.
